The STM32L151RET6TR belongs to the category of microcontrollers and is specifically designed for low-power applications. This microcontroller offers a wide range of features and characteristics suitable for various electronic devices. The package type for this product is LQFP, and it is available in tape and reel packaging with a quantity of 2500 units per reel.
The STM32L151RET6TR features a comprehensive pin configuration that includes multiple GPIO pins, power supply pins, communication interface pins, and other essential connections. A detailed pinout diagram is available in the product datasheet.
The STM32L151RET6TR operates based on the ARM Cortex-M3 core architecture, providing efficient processing capabilities while maintaining low power consumption. It utilizes advanced peripherals and flexible clocking options to cater to a wide range of application requirements.
The STM32L151RET6TR is well-suited for applications requiring low-power operation and advanced control capabilities. Some of the key application fields include: - Battery-powered devices - Sensor nodes - Wearable electronics - Industrial control systems - IoT (Internet of Things) devices
